With less than a week before the end of the campaign period for the mid-term elections, Vice President Sara Duterte is finding herself hard at work campaigning for her father’s “Duter10” senatorial bets.

VP Sara's campaign efforts for 'Duter10' shifts to higher gear

The official said, in a media interview on Saturday night, May 3, that she will be barnstorming Zamboanga Sibugay, and North Cotabato in the following days.

She has yet to join her father’s Partido Demokratiko Pilipino-Lakas ng Bayan (PDP-Laban) bets on the campaign trail, but the Vice President revealed she might be present for the Miting de Avance on May 8.

"March (May) 8 supposedly. March (May) 8 supposedly ang Miting de Avance ng PDP pero nahihirapan ako ayusin yung schedule ko sa daming — sa dami ng mga candidates na nagrequest na mabisita yung kanilang lugar at makakampanya para sa sampung senador (the Miting de Avance of PDP but I’m having a hard time fixing my schedule because there are a lot—a lot of candidates are requesting me to visit their areas to campaign for the 10 senators)," she said.
